Game Flow: From Bet to Cash Out in Seconds
The core loop is simple yet engaging: set your stake, pick a difficulty level, watch the chicken hop across the road, and decide when to cash out before it hits an obstacle.
Because the decision point is immediate after each step, you’re constantly involved in the outcome. The interface is clean—just a clear multiplier counter and a single button that toggles between “Continue” and “Cash Out.” No auto‑play options mean you’re never left waiting for software to make decisions for you.
The result? A highly immersive experience that rewards quick thinking and precise timing.
Choosing the Right Difficulty for Fast Wins
Selecting the correct difficulty level is crucial when you’re playing short sessions. Each level adjusts the number of steps the chicken must complete and the risk per step.
- Easy (24 steps): Low risk, modest multipliers—ideal for beginners.
- Medium (22 steps): A balanced mix of risk and reward.
- Hard (20 steps): Higher risk but better potential multipliers.
- Hardcore (15 steps): Extreme risk with a 10/25 chance of losing each step.
